History of the Exchange Rate

The exchange rate between HKD and PHP has experienced significant fluctuations over the years. In 2010, the exchange rate was around 1 HKD = 5.50 PHP. Since then, the PHP has weakened against the HKD, resulting in the current exchange rate.

Factors Affecting the Exchange Rate

Several factors influence the exchange rate between HKD and PHP, including:

Economic Performance

The economic performance of both Hong Kong and the Philippines plays a significant role in determining the exchange rate. A strong economy typically leads to a stronger currency.

Inflation Rates

Inflation rates in both countries also impact the exchange rate. Higher inflation rates in the Philippines compared to Hong Kong can lead to a depreciation of the PHP against the HKD.

Monetary Policy

Central banks in both countries, the Hong Kong Monetary Authority (HKMA) and the Bangko Sentral ng Pilipinas (BSP), implement monetary policies that affect the exchange rate.

Global Events

Global events, such as trade wars, natural disasters, and pandemics, can cause fluctuations in the exchange rate.
